Nestled beside two beautiful ponds, Millsboro prides itself on being a business-friendly and family-oriented town. In 2018, this small town was ranked the top city out of 25 Sussex County cities for the number of residential building permits issued, a leading indication of population. Businesses continue to establish themselves in town monthly. Millsboro is very safe with excellent schools.
There is plenty to do in and around this up-and-coming city. If you’re looking for some in-town fun, bowl at Millsboro Lanes or get in touch with your creative side and take a class at the Millsboro Art League. Head to Cupola Park to crab, fish, or just meditate by Millsboro pond’s calming waters. Just 30 minutes away, enjoy a sales-tax-free shopping spree at the Tanger Outlets. Experience Delaware’s largest water park with bumper boats, batting cages, and mini golf at Jungle Jim’s in nearby Rehoboth.

The GreatSchools Rating helps parents compare schools within a state based on a variety of school quality indicators and provides a helpful picture of how effectively each school serves all of its students. Ratings are on a scale of 1 (below average) to 10 (above average) and can include test scores, college readiness, academic progress, advanced courses, equity, discipline and attendance data. We also advise parents to visit schools, consider other information on school performance and programs, and consider family needs as part of the school selection process.

Everything started well, we called management and talked about the apartment, they gave all the necessary information, and later we called each other a couple more times to make sure everything is going well. We made an appointment and told them that we live in another state and it would take 6 hours to get there, they told us not to worry and that they would meet us on time. we prepared all the necessary documents, copies of which we were told to bring in order to immediately sign the agreemen. We drove there for 6 hours, arrived at the townhouse indicated to us at the indicated time, there was another family who had already rented this townhouse. Management didn’t come and stopped answering the phone, didn’t answer emails, we been there for several hours and no one came to us and they simply ignored us.We had to literally find a new apartment in an hour and immediately sign an agreement, since we arrived there only for one day, and were already fully expecting to move to Burton’s Crossing Townhomes.
